Neston High Celebrates Revamp of Student Support Area
Author: Katie Robson | Published: 29th January 2013 15:11 |
Students, teachers, parents and community visitors came together this week to celebrate the official opening of the newly revamped Student Support area, Overton 8, at Neston High School.
Amongst the guests at the event were Mayor of Neston, Cllr Pat Hughes and his wife Marie, Chair of the Governors Reg Chrimes and Head Teacher Mr Steve Dool. All were served coffee, tea and biscuits by students keen to show off their new surroundings.
Formerly a functional but rather dull space was divided into two classrooms with no 'soft' areas for relaxation. Special Educational Needs Co-ordinator Mrs Kath Thomson was keen to involve students in the overhaul to ensure their future needs were met. She explains: "Some of our older students, who have been using the area for a few years now, were very involved in the designs for the space.
"They chose calming colours, helped to plan areas for work and relaxation and created space to allow those with physical disabilities to move safely.
"We are busy before school, at break and lunch, as well as during lesson times when students access small group or individual support in literacy, numeracy, communication skills, speech and language therapy.
"Students can also come along after school - we run a homework club along with a fun literacy club and a maths group. In all, around 50 students use the area every day, so it was important to ensure that we came up with designs suitable for an inclusive environment, both relaxing and practical."
One of the students involved in the design is Alex. Whilst removing old fixed wall cupboards in preparation for the refurb, a maths exercise book appeared which had work in it from years ago. The name was tracked and the book was returned to its rightful owner - Alex's mother!
Some of the students' designs can be seen in our photos below and several of the budding designers presided over the official ribbon-cutting to declare their new area open (above). As the brochure handed to guests highlighted - "Overton 8 was designed by students for students. Supporting each other to work and socialise together in a calm, comfortable environment."
